Mocha is a JavaScript test framework for Node.js programs, featuring browser support, asynchronous testing, test coverage reports, and use of any assertion library.cite-ref-2[2]

Assertion libraries

Mocha can be used with most JavaScript assertion libraries, including:

• should.js
• express.js
• chai
• better-assert
• unexpected

Usage and examples

$ npm install -g mocha
$ mkdir test
$ $EDITOR test/test.js # or open with your favorite editor

var assert = require("assert")
describe('Foo', function(){
describe('#getBar(value)', function() {
it('should return 100 when value is negative') // placeholder
it('should return 0 when value is positive', function() {
assert.equal(0, Foo.getBar(10));
})
})
})

$ mocha
.
1 test complete (1ms)

For asynchronous testing, invoke the callback, and Mocha will wait for completion.

describe('Foo', function(){
describe('#bar()', function() {
it('should work without error', function(done) {
var foo = new Foo(128);
foo.bar(done);
})
})
})
